MySQL连接数据命令详解

MySQL是一个开源的关系型数据库管理系统,广泛应用于各种Web应用程序中。连接数据库是使用MySQL的第一步,本文将详细介绍MySQL连接数据的命令。

前提条件

在连接MySQL数据库之前,需要满足以下前提条件:

  1. 安装MySQL数据库:在本地或者远程服务器上安装MySQL数据库。
  2. 确认MySQL服务已经启动:确保MySQL服务已经在运行。

连接MySQL数据库

连接MySQL数据库可以使用命令行工具或者编程语言中的MySQL驱动程序。下面分别介绍这两种方式。

命令行工具连接MySQL数据库

命令行工具可以使用mysql命令连接MySQL数据库。使用该命令需要提供以下参数:

  • -h--host:MySQL数据库所在的主机名或IP地址。
  • -P--port:MySQL数据库的端口号,默认为3306。
  • -u--user:连接MySQL数据库的用户名。
  • -p--password:连接MySQL数据库的密码。

以下是连接MySQL数据库的示例命令:

mysql -h localhost -P 3306 -u root -p

在命令行中执行以上命令后,会提示输入密码,输入正确的密码后即可连接到MySQL数据库。如果连接成功,将会出现MySQL的命令行提示符。

编程语言连接MySQL数据库

各种编程语言都提供了连接MySQL数据库的API或驱动程序。下面以Python为例介绍如何使用MySQL驱动程序连接MySQL数据库。

首先,需要安装Python的MySQL驱动程序。可以使用以下命令安装MySQL驱动程序:

pip install mysql-connector-python

安装完成后,可以使用以下代码连接MySQL数据库:

import mysql.connector

# 创建连接
cnx = mysql.connector.connect(
    host="localhost",
    port=3306,
    user="root",
    password="password",
    database="mydatabase"
)

# 连接成功后的操作
if cnx.is_connected():
    print("已成功连接到MySQL数据库")

# 关闭连接
cnx.close()

以上代码使用mysql.connector模块创建了一个MySQL连接对象cnx,并指定了连接MySQL数据库的参数。连接成功后,可以执行需要的操作,最后关闭连接。

流程图

下面是连接MySQL数据库的流程图:

flowchart TD
    A[开始] --> B[安装MySQL数据库]
    B --> C[确认MySQL服务已启动]
    A --> D[使用命令行工具连接MySQL数据库]
    D --> E[输入连接参数]
    E --> F[连接MySQL数据库]
    F --> G[执行操作]
    G --> H[关闭连接]
    A --> I[使用编程语言连接MySQL数据库]
    I --> J[导入MySQL驱动程序]
    J --> K[创建连接对象]
    K --> L[连接MySQL数据库]
    L --> M[执行操作]
    M --> N[关闭连接]
    H --> O[结束]
    N --> O

总结

本文介绍了使用命令行工具和编程语言连接MySQL数据库的方法,并提供了相应的代码示例。MySQL是一个功能强大的数据库管理系统,掌握连接MySQL数据库的方法对于开发者来说非常重要。希望本文能够帮助读者理解和掌握MySQL连接数据命令,进一步提升开发效率。